EVERSON, PENNSYLVANIA QUICK STATSCounty: Fayette
Elevation: 1060 feet
Land Area: 0.22 square miles
Population Density: 3617 people per square mile
Population: 787
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(96.1%), Black (3.4%)
Ancestries (City): Polish (33.7%), German (15.3%), Irish (11.8%), United States (8.9%), Italian (6.9%), Slovak (3.3%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Pittsburgh, PA (31.8 miles , pop. 334,563)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Philadelphia, PA (235.3 miles , pop. 1,517,550)
Nearest cities: Scottdale borough, PA (0.9 miles ), Mount Pleasant borough, PA (2.2 miles ), Dawson borough, PA (2.2 miles ), Connellsville, PA (2.3 miles ), Vanderbilt borough, PA (2.4 miles ), South Connellsville borough, PA (2.5 miles ), Dunbar borough, PA (2.8 miles ), Hunker borough, PA (2.8 miles )
Everson Compared to State Average: Median house value below state average. Unemployed percentage below state average. Black race population percentage significantly below state average.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average. Median age above state average.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average. Length of stay since moving in significantly above state average. House age significantly above state average. Number of college students below state average.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her significantly below state average.
EVERSON, PENNSYLVANIA E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 74.80%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 7.20%
Graduate or professional degree: 0.50%
